Mupider ointment is indicated for the topical treatment of the following primary and secondary skin infections due to susceptible pathogens: primary pyodermas such as impetigo, folliculitis, furunculosis, ecthyma; secondary infected dermatoses such as eczema, psoriasis, atopic dermatitis, herpes, epidermolysis bullosa, icthyosis, and infected traumatic lesions such as ulcers, minor burns, cuts, abrasions, lacerations, wounds, biopsy sites, surgical incisions and insect bites. Prophylactically, Mupider ointment may be used to prevent bacterial contamination in minor burns, biopsy sites, incisions and other clean lesions. For abrasions, minor cuts and wounds the prophylatic use of Mupider may prevent the development of infection and permit wound healing.

WHAT MUPIDER IS USED FOR Mupider ointment contains mupirocin (2% w/w) as the active ingredient. Mupirocin belongs to a group of medicines called antibiotics. Antibiotics work by killing bacteria, which can cause infection. Mupider ointment is used for the treatment of certain types of skin infections such as school sores (impetigo), infection of the hair root and boils. Mupider is also used when infection occurs in skin damaged by eczema, dermatitis, psoriasis, herpes (cold sores), wounds, cuts, grazes, insect bites, minor burns etc. Mupider ointment is for use on your skin only. 1 MUPIDER ® MUPIROCIN OINTMENT 2% W/W Page 1 of 8 NEW ZEALAND DATA SHEET 1 MUPIDER ® (2% OINTMENT) MUPIDER 2% Ointment 2 QUALITATIVE AND QUANTITATIVE COMPOSITION Mupider 2% Ointment contains 20 mg mupirocin per gram in polyethylene glycol base. For the full list of excipients, see section 6.1. 3 PHARMACEUTICAL FORM Mupider ointment is semi-transparent and water-soluble 4 CLINICAL PARTICULARS 4.1 THERAPEUTIC INDICATIONS Mupider ointment is indicated for the topical treatment of the following primary and secondary skin infections due to susceptible pathogens: primary pyodermas such as impetigo, folliculitis, furunculosis, ecthyma; secondary infected dermatoses such as eczema, psoriasis, atopic dermatitis, herpes, epidermolysis bullosa, ichthyosis, and infected traumatic lesions such as ulcers, minor burns, cuts, abrasions, lacerations, wounds, biopsy sites, surgical incisions and insect bites. Prophylactically, Mupider ointment may be used to prevent bacterial contamination in minor burns, biopsy sites, incisions and other clean lesions. For abrasions, minor cuts and wounds the prophylactic use of Mupider may prevent the development of infection and permit wound healing. 4.2 DOSE AND METHOD OF ADMINISTRATION Dose Adults (including elderly/hepatically impaired) and children A small amount of Mupider ointment should be applied to the affected area three times daily for up to 10 days, depending on the response. The area treated may be covered 2 MUPIDER ® MUPIROCIN OINTMENT 2% W/W Page 2 of 8 with a gauze dressing if required. Any product remaining at the end of treatment should be discarded. Do not mix with other preparations as there is a risk of dilution, resulting in a reduction in the antibacterial activity and potential loss of stability of the mupirocin in the ointment.
